A new public education campaign has been launched by the Commission on Government Efficiency ahead of National Voter Registration Day, focusing on informing voters about proposed ballot measures numbered 1 through 5. The initiative aims to clarify the details of each proposition to help residents make informed decisions when casting their ballots. With registration efforts underway, the campaign seeks to ensure voters are aware of the key issues at stake in the upcoming proposals. Details on how the measures could impact local governance and services are expected to be highlighted.
